U.S. SOL spot ETF experienced a total net outflow of $248,420 in a single day
Odaily Planet Daily reports that according to SoSoValue data, on March 9th (Eastern Time), the total net outflow of SOL spot ETFs was $2.4842 million.
The SOL spot ETF with the largest net outflow yesterday was VanEck Solana ETF (VSOL), with a daily net outflow of $1.9781 million. Its total net inflow to date has reached $19.1157 million.
The second was Fidelity Solana Fund ETF (FSOL), with a daily net outflow of $506,200. Its total net inflow to date has reached $152 million.
As of press time, the total net asset value of SOL spot ETFs was $814 million, with a SOL net asset ratio of 1.66%. The total net inflow historically has reached $955 million.
